推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
比特币现金近日引入Schnorr签名技术,这一突破性进展大幅提升了钱包签名的安全性与效率。Schnorr签名不仅增强了隐私保护,还优化了交易处理速度,为加密货币领域带来了新的技术革新。
本文目录导读:
随着数字货币的快速发展,比特币现金(Bitcoin Cash, BCH)作为一种重要的加密货币,其安全性一直是社区关注的焦点,近年来,Schnorr签名作为一种新型加密签名算法,逐渐成为提升比特币现金安全性和效率的关键技术,本文将详细介绍比特币现金Schnorr签名的原理、优势及其在比特币现金网络中的应用。
Schnorr签名的原理
Schnorr签名是一种基于椭圆曲线密码学(ECDSA)的数字签名算法,由德国数学家克劳斯·施诺尔(Claude Schnorr)在1989年提出,Schnorr签名算法的核心思想是将签名者的私钥与消息内容进行加密,生成一个不可伪造的签名,具体步骤如下:
1、签名者生成一对椭圆曲线公私钥(x, y),公钥y = xG,其中G为椭圆曲线的基点。
2、签名者选择一个随机数k作为签名密钥,并计算R = kG。
3、签名者计算签名r = xR mod n,其中n为椭圆曲线的阶。
4、签名者将签名r和消息内容m发送给验证者。
验证者收到签名后,进行以下验证步骤:
1、验证者计算s = r + H(m) * x mod n,其中H为哈希函数。
2、验证者计算R' = sG - H(m) * R。
3、如果R'的x坐标与签名r相同,则签名有效。
比特币现金Schnorr签名的优势
1、安全性更高:Schnorr签名算法在理论上比ECDSA更安全,因为它可以抵抗某些针对ECDSA的攻击,如侧信道攻击和故障攻击。
2、签名更短:Schnorr签名的长度固定为64字节,而ECDSA签名的长度为72字节,这意味着Schnorr签名在存储和传输过程中占用更少的资源。
3、多重签名更高效:Schnorr签名支持多重签名,即多个签名者共同对同一消息进行签名,与ECDSA相比,Schnorr签名的多重签名在计算和验证过程中更加高效。
4、更好的匿名性:Schnorr签名可以与匿名技术(如零知识证明)结合使用,提高比特币现金交易的匿名性。
比特币现金Schnorr签名的应用
1、提高交易效率:Schnorr签名可以降低比特币现金交易的大小,从而减少交易费用,提高网络处理能力。
2、提高安全性:Schnorr签名可以抵抗某些针对比特币现金的攻击,如重放攻击和交易劫持攻击。
3、促进隐私保护:Schnorr签名可以与匿名技术结合,为比特币现金用户提供更好的隐私保护。
4、推动创新:Schnorr签名的引入为比特币现金生态系统带来了新的可能性,如多重签名、智能合约等。
比特币现金Schnorr签名作为一种新型加密签名算法,具有更高的安全性和效率,其应用不仅可以提高比特币现金网络的处理能力,还能为用户提供更好的隐私保护和创新可能性,随着Schnorr签名在比特币现金社区的推广和应用,我们有理由相信,比特币现金将迎来更加美好的未来。
以下是50个中文相关关键词:
比特币现金, Schnorr签名, 加密货币, 安全性, 效率, 椭圆曲线密码学, ECDSA, 数字签名, 算法, 原理, 优势, 应用, 交易效率, 隐私保护, 攻击, 防御, 多重签名, 匿名技术, 零知识证明, 智能合约, 网络处理能力, 交易费用, 验证, 公私钥, 基点, 随机数, 消息内容, 哈希函数, 签名长度, 资源占用, 多重签名效率, 匿名性, 隐私保护技术, 安全机制, 生态系统, 创新应用, 侧信道攻击, 故障攻击, 重放攻击, 交易劫持攻击, 防护措施, 社区推广, 技术进步, 数字货币发展, 加密技术, 网络安全, 隐私权
本文标签属性:
比特币现金:比特币现金是什么意思
Schnorr签名技术:签名设备
比特币现金Schnorr签名:比特币数字签名过程